Note: It's not a goal to make CH backend + VL backend work together as of now ([reason](https://github.com/apache/incubator-gluten/pull/8143#issuecomment-2519635299)). If you got any requirement like this please let me know.

Currently only one single backend can be used at the same time in Gluten. This topic suggests a plug-able system to allow enabling multiple backends at compile time (at runtime in future, maybe). For example, eventually one could build Gluten with `-P backends-velox,backends-another` to enable both Velox backend and `another` backend that could possibly be added to Gluten code base in future. In the case when a query is being run, Gluten's query planner could choose the best path to implement the physical plan that may be a mixing of Velox sub-plans and `another` sub-plans.

The feature could drive Gluten to evolve from a hand-written middle layer to a development platform to offload Spark SQL with different data formats, acceleration libraries, or hardware architectures.

Prior to doing this, a bunch of preparation work should be done including essential code refactors.
